“Like so much of cool hunting, Hilfiger's marketing journey feeds off the alienation at the heart of America's race relations: selling white youth on their fetishization of black style, and black youth on their fetishization of white wealth.”
Source: No Logo: Taking Aim at the Brand Bullies 1999, Chapter Five: "The Patriarchy Gets Funky"
